摘要

The primary purpose of the proposed rule is to address interstate air quality impacts with respect to the 2008 ozone National Ambient Air Quality Standards (NAAQS). The EPA promulgated the Cross-State Air Pollution Rule (CSAPR) on July 6, 2011,1 to address interstate transport of ozone pollution under the 1997 ozone NAAQS.2 The proposed rule would update CSAPR to address interstate emissions transport of nitrogen oxides (NOX) that contribute significantly to nonattainment or interfere with maintenance of the 2008 ozone NAAQS in downwind states. The proposed rule also responds to the D.C. Circuit’s July 28, 2015 remand of certain CSAPR ozone season NOX emissions budgets to the EPA for reconsideration. This Regulatory Impact Analysis (RIA) presents the health and welfare benefits and climate co-benefits of the proposal to update CSAPR, and compares the benefits to the estimated costs of implementing the proposed rule for the 2017 analysis year. This RIA also reports certain impacts of the proposed rule such as its effect on employment and energy prices. This executive summary both explains the analytic approach taken in the RIA and summarizes the RIA results.
